Here’s something that might curl in your noodle…When Mitchell Tenpenny was young, he played drums in a hardcore Metal band. His mother supported him, because . . . moms. And then he grew up. In college he focused on acoustic guitar and songwriting. Mom didn’t have to pretend about liking that. The first time he played her one of his songs she started tearing up and crying, tears of joy of course because he wasn’t playing all that screaming Metal music.

Alec Baldwin’s ill-fated movie “Rust” was hit Wednesday with the maximum possible fine by state safety officials in New Mexico for violations on the set that contributed to the death of a cinematographer.
Sighting “plain indifference” by the production and noted they “willfully violated” known industry safety protocols and imposed a $137,000 fine for firearms safety failures.
As for the guy that pointed the gun and pulled the trigger? Well, he’s being sued civilly by the victim’s family.
